Damian Lillard traded to Milwaukee Bucks

Dame to the Bucks - What Does This Mean For NBA Championship Odds?

And just like that, the Damian Lillard trade saga is finally over.

With an Adrian Wojnarowski #WojBomb, the NBA world learned that the seven-time NBA All-Star is on his way to the Milwaukee Bucks.

Wednesday afternoon's move is sure to send shockwaves felt for years in the Association. Let's dive into the betting impact of yet another blockbuster NBA trade.

Fallout of Dame Lillard Leaving Portland

Lillard leaving his longtime Pacific Northwest home always seemed to be an eventuality. Although he preached loyalty to the Portland Trail Blazers franchise for years, in this era of player movement, this is the best move for the Dame Dolla's career. The Weber State University alum was never going to waste his final prime years playing for a franchise with no hope of contending for an NBA Championship.

Wojnarowski reports that the Blazers will receive a package of veteran players and picks for one of the best players in franchise history. DeAndre Ayton, Jrue Holiday, Toumani Coumara, a 2029 unprotected first-round pick, and two first-round pick swaps from Milwaukee will head to Portland as part of a three-team deal with the Phoenix Suns. Portland will surely look to offload Holiday and perhaps Ayton, too, as the Blazers fully commit to building for the future.

Anfernee Simons is the defacto leader of the Blazers now, with Canadian guard Shaedon Sharpe and rookie Scoot Henderson rounding out the young core. Portland's odds to win the Northwest division cratered from +7500 to +15000 with the news.

Giannis Will Welcome Dame With Open Arms

The undoubted winner of Wednesday's news is Giannis Antetokounmpo. Any way you slice it, the Milwaukee Bucks offense has been persistently mediocre since they lifted the Larry O'Brien trophy in 2021.

Milwaukee has often relied too heavily on its superstar on the offensive end. With Khris Middleton often injured and Jrue Holiday far from an offensive savant, teams have found a way to stifle the Bucks' scoring in the playoffs without a true weapon opposite "the Greek Freak."

Now, opposing defenders will have to contend with a career 25-point-per-game scorer, the immovable object of Giannis, and the marvelous mid-range skills of Middleton, should he remain healthy.

Lillard is unquestionably one of the greatest shooters of all-time and immediately changes the entire complexion of the Bucks entire franchise. Last week, ESPN was running features on where Giannis could possibly sign once his contract runs out next summer. Now, with one Jon Horst masterstroke, the Bucks are once again the favorites to win the NBA Championship. Milwaukee has surpassed the Phoenix Suns superteam +600, vaunted Boston Celtics +500, and the defending champion Denver Nuggets +475 in one fell swoop. Bucks ownership has to be ecstatic.

NBA MVP Award in Play for Giannis

With Damian Lillard in tow to lessen the load, a third NBA MVP award is now very much on the table for Giannis Antetokounmpo. Giannis will have the most help he's ever had offensively, as Lillard is the perfect complement to his interior dominance.

Antetokounmpo now sits third in the NBA MVP odds at +550, trailing only Luka Doncic at +500 and favorite Nikola Jokic at +450 odds. Following his move to a contending franchise, Lillard himself has entered the conversation at +2200 odds to win his first Most Valuable Player award. The superstars' dynamic will be fun to watch as the NBA season gets underway in late October. We'll have a good idea of the Bucks status in the NBA hierarchy immediately, as Milwaukee hosts 2022 NBA MVP Joel Embiid and the Philadelphia 76ers on October 26th.
